See your dentist: Sensitive teeth are typically the cause of worn tooth enamel or exposed tooth roots. Sometimes, however, tooth discomfort is caused by other factors, such a cracked, chipped or infected teeth. If you're concerned about sensitive teeth and hurting gums the good starting point is to call your dentist. He or she will find the cause and treat accordingly. Take care.
